Rennie Antacid is a medicine that neutralizes excess stomach acid.
It contains two active substances: calcium carbonate and magnesium carbonate.

Rennie Antacid may affect the rate and extent of absorption of other medicines. Therefore,
all medicines, especially those listed below, should be taken 1 or 2 hours before or after
taking Rennie Antacid:
The medicine should be taken after a meal. The medicine should not be taken with large amounts of milk or
dairy products.
If the patient is pregnant or breastfeeding, thinks she may be pregnant, or plans to have a child, she should consult a doctor or pharmacist before taking this medicine. Rennie Antacid can be used during pregnancy and breastfeeding. However, the recommended doses should be strictly followed and the medicine should be used as directed. The medicine should not be used for more than 2 weeks.

One tablet contains 475 mg of sucrose. This should be taken into account in patients with
diabetes.
If the patient has previously been diagnosed with intolerance to some sugars, the patient should
consult a doctor before taking the medicine.

Adults and children over 12 years old:
1 to 2 tablets at a time, 1 hour after a meal and before bedtime.
No more than 11 tablets should be taken per day.
If symptoms do not improve within 7 daysor improve only partially, the doctor should be consulted, as tests are recommended to rule out a more serious disease.
Rennie Antacid should not be used in children under 12 years old.
In case of taking a higher dose of the medicine than recommended, the medicine should be stopped and plenty of fluids should be given to drink.

Long-term use of high doses, especially in patients with impaired kidney function, may cause hypermagnesemia (elevated magnesium levels in the blood) or hypercalcemia (elevated calcium levels in the blood) and alkalosis (elevated blood pH).

The medicine should be stored out of sight and reach of children.
Store in a temperature below 25°C. Store in the original packaging to protect from moisture.
Do not use this medicine after the expiry date stated on the packaging.
The expiry date refers to the last day of the month stated.
Medicines should not be disposed of via wastewater or household waste containers. The pharmacist should be asked how to dispose of medicines that are no longer used. This will help protect the environment.
The active substances of the medicine are: calcium carbonate and magnesium carbonate.
The medicine contains 680 mg of calcium carbonate and 80 mg of magnesium carbonate.
The other ingredients of the medicine are: sucrose, maize starch, potato starch, magnesium stearate, talc, light liquid paraffin, peppermint flavor, lemon flavor.
The medicine is in the form of white, square tablets with the inscription: "RENNIE". The tablets are packaged in blisters.
The packaging contains 12, 24, 36, 48, or 96 chewable tablets.
